Species Specific
Characteristics or behaviors that are unique to a particular species.
Hybrid Inviability
A postzygotic barrier where offspring resulting from the mating of two different species die prematurely due to genetic incompatibilities.
Alloploid
An organism having two or more sets of chromosomes that are derived from two different species.
Chromosomes
Proteinous, string-like entities situated in the cell nucleus of animals and plants, containing a single DNA molecule.
